SEZ Technopolis Moscow will cooperate with the free economic zones of Armenia
The special economic zone of the capital has agreed on cooperation with two free economic zones of Armenia - Alliance and Meghri. This was announced by the head of the Department of Investment and Industrial Policy, which is part of the Complex of Economic Policy and Property and Land Relations of the capital, Vladislav Ovchinsky. “The exchange of best practices at the interstate level will give an additional impetus to the development of infrastructure sites and attract investment. For residents of the metropolitan SEZ, this is an opportunity to increase the volume of exported products and enter new markets,” Vladislav Ovchinsky emphasized. Companies localized in the territories of economic zones intend to actively exchange information, participate in joint projects and help each other in finding new partners. “This will create comfortable conditions for work and cooperation between Russian and Armenian enterprises. The Moscow Special Economic Zone is ready to strengthen international cooperation to increase the demand for high technologies and introduce the latest solutions. Many years of experience in the development of high-tech industries will serve as a good basis for building a mutual dialogue,” said Gennady Degtev, CEO of the SEZ Technopolis Moscow. Free economic zone Alliance was established in 2013, this is the first territory of this type in Armenia. There are concentrated high-tech manufacturers from the industries of IT, electronics, precision engineering, pharmaceuticals, biotechnology, alternative energy and telecommunications. Many of these companies specialize in the production of import-substituting products and have significant experience in this area. FEZ Meghri started its activity in 2017. Currently has the largest industry coverage in Armenia. The companies localized on its territory are not only in the areas of production and processing, but are also engaged in agriculture, electricity supply, and provide services in the field of transport, tourism, entertainment and recreation.
